The field strength of stationary transmitters, such as base stations of wireless
phones and cell phones, ham radio operators, AM and FM radio and TV stations
theoretically cannot always be determined in advance. A study of the installation
site should be considered to determine the electromagnetic environment con-
cerning the stationary transmitter. If the field strength measured at the usage
site of the device FLUID CONTROL Lap 2216 exceeds the compliance levels listed
above, the device FLUID CONTROL Lap 2216 should be monitored for proper func-
tion. If unusual performance characteristics are observed, additional measures
may be required such as changing orientation or the location of the device FLUID
CONTROL Lap 2216.

DANGER!
Portable HF communication devices can have an effect on the performance char-
acteristics of the device FLUID CONTROL Lap 2216. Therefore, such devices must
be kept at a minimum distance of 30 cm (independent of any calculation) from
the device FLUID CONTROL Lap 2216, its accessories, and the cables.
